Amtelco - McFarland, WI

posted 6 months ago

Full-time - Mid Level
Remote - McFarland, WI
Furniture, Home Furnishings, Electronics, and Appliance Retailers

About the position

Amtelco is seeking an Android Mobile Applications Developer to join our Software department, specifically for our Secure Texting Application. This full-time position is based at our corporate headquarters in McFarland, WI, and reports to the Secure Texting Product Manager and Team Lead Application Developer. As a family-owned company that has been recognized as a Top Workplace in the Madison, WI area for five consecutive years, we pride ourselves on fostering a supportive and inclusive environment that values work-life balance. We are committed to listening to our team members and implementing initiatives that matter to them. In this role, you will collaborate with internal teams to develop functional mobile applications, focusing on creating user-friendly experiences. You will work independently and as part of the Mobile Applications Development Team to develop and maintain Android versions of Amtelco's communications applications. Your responsibilities will include supporting the entire application lifecycle, from concept and design to testing, publishing, and support. You will produce fully functional applications by writing clean code, gathering specific requirements, and suggesting solutions. Additionally, you will perform unit and UI tests to identify malfunctions and participate in code reviews with team members and senior software engineers. We are looking for someone who is passionate about mobile platforms and has a strong understanding of UI and UX principles. You will be expected to stay up to date with new technology trends and work closely with the Product Development Team to plan new features. Your role will also involve assisting the Field Engineering Team in troubleshooting customer-reported issues, ensuring that both new and legacy applications meet quality standards. If you are eager to contribute to our mission of providing the best products and support to our customers, we would love to meet you!

Responsibilities

  • Develop and maintain Android versions of Amtelco's communications applications.
  • Support the entire application lifecycle including concept, design, testing, publishing, and support.
  • Produce fully functional applications by writing clean code.
  • Gather specific requirements and suggest solutions.
  • Perform unit and UI tests to identify malfunctions, with automated testing as a plus.
  • Participate in code reviews with the Mobile Applications Development Team members and Senior Software Engineers.
  • Troubleshoot and debug to optimize performance.
  • Design interfaces to improve user experience (UX).
  • Work with the Product Development Team to plan new features.
  • Ensure new and legacy applications meet quality standards.
  • Research and suggest new mobile products, applications, and protocols.
  • Stay up to date with new technology trends.
  • Work with the Software Documentation Team to develop system administration and user reference guides as well as online help files.
  • Assist the Field Engineering Team in troubleshooting customer-reported issues.

Requirements

  • Proven work experience (2 - 3 years) as a Mobile Developer with knowledge of Android development using Kotlin/Android Studio.
  • Knowledge of Apple development with Swift is a plus.
  • Additional relevant work experience, with an emphasis in software engineering and development, is preferred.
  • Knowledge of Jetpack Compose UI framework.
  • Knowledge of Model-View-ViewModel (MVVM) architecture.
  • Knowledge of JavaScript, Visual Studio, and/or C# programming is a plus.
  • Knowledge of GitHub and Jira (Agile Methodologies).
  • Excellent analytical skills with good problem-solving skills.
  • Reliable with a professional attitude and good communication skills.
  • Experience in an answering service and/or healthcare environment is helpful.

Nice-to-haves

  • Knowledge of Apple development with Swift.
  • Experience with Jetpack Compose UI framework.
  • Familiarity with Model-View-ViewModel (MVVM) architecture.
  • Experience in an answering service and/or healthcare environment.

Benefits

  • 401(k)
  • Dental insurance
  • Employee assistance program
  • Flexible schedule
  • Flexible spending account
  • Health insurance
  • Health savings account
  • Life insurance
  • Paid time off
  • Vision insurance
  • Semiannual bonus
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service